Yes, in many ways 'Great Expectations' can be considered one of the best novels. Its complex characters like Pip, Estella, and Miss Havisham are so vividly drawn. The exploration of themes such as social class, ambition, and love is profound. Dickens' writing style, with his detailed descriptions of Victorian England, makes the story come alive. It has influenced countless other works of literature and has remained popular over time, which all contribute to its status as a great, if not the best, novel.
Fiction. The characters in 'Great Expectations' such as Pip, Estella, and Miss Havisham are all creations of Dickens' imagination. The plot, which follows Pip's journey from a young boy with great expectations to a man who has to face the harsh realities of life, is a work of fiction. It's a classic example of Victorian - era fictional literature.
